1b determine model and year of manufacture of Suzuki outboard motors, refer
to numbers located on motor clamp bracket. The first six characters indicate the
model and second six characters are motor serial number. The first character of
serial number indicates year of manufacture. The years 1977, 1978 and 1979 are
identified by the letters "C," "D" and "F" respectively. Starting with 1980, the
first number in serial number corresponds with model year. For example, if first
number in serial number is 1, model year is 1981.

LUBRICATION
The power head is lubricated by oil
mixed with the fuel. Fuel:oil ratios
should be 30:1 during break-in of a new
or rebuilt engine and 50:1 for normal
service when using a BIA certified TC-W
engine oil or Suzuki "CCI" oil. When us-
ing any other type of two-stroke engine
oil. fuel:oil ratios should be 20:1 during
break-in and 30:1 for normal service.
Manufacturer recommends regular or
no-lead automotive gasoline having an
85-95 octane rating. Gasoline and oil
should be thoroughly mixed.
The lower unit gears and bearings are
lubricated by approximately 85 mL (2.9
ozs.) of SAE 90 hypoid outboard gear
oil. Reinstall vent and fill plugs securely
using a new gasket, if necessary. to en-
sure a water tight seal.

FUEL SYSTEM
CARBURETOR. A Mikuni BV-18-15
carburetor is used. Refer to Fig. SZ2-1
for exploded view. Initial setting of pilot
air screw (15) from a lightly seated posi-
tion should be 3/.-11/. turns. Final car-
buretor adjustment should be made with
engine at normal operating temperature
and running in forward gear. Adjust
throttle stop screw (12) so engine idles
at approximately 900-1000 rpm. Adjust
pilot air screw so engine idles smooth
and will accelerate c1eanlv without
hesitation. If necessary. readjust throt-
tle stop screw to obtain 900-1000 rpm
idle speed.
Main fuel metering is controlled by
main jet (2). Standard main jet size for
normal operation is #90. Standard pilot
jet (14) size is #15.

To check float level. remove float bowl
(7) and invert carburetor body (1). Base
of float (6) should be 12-14 rnm (0.47-
0.55 in.) away from sealing ring surface
of carburetor body with sealing ring (3)
removed. Adjust float level by bending
float tang.
FUEL PUMP. A diaphragm fuel
pump (Fig. SZ2-2) is mounted on the
side of power head cylinder blOCk and is
actuated by pressure and vacuum pulsa-
tions from the engine crankcase.
When servicing pump. defective or
questionable parts should be renewed.
Diaphragm should be renewed if air
leaks or cracks are found. or if
deterioration is evident.

LUBRICATION
The power head is lubricated by oil
mixed with the fuel. Fuel:oil ratios
should be 30:1 during break-in of a new
or rebuilt engine. For normal service,
fuel:oil ratio should be 50: 1 on models
prior to 1986 and 100:1 on 1986 and
later models when using Suzuki Out-
board Motor Oil or a good quality NMMA
certified TC-W engine oil. When using
any other two-stroke oil, fuel:oil ratio
should be 20: 1 during break-in and 30:1
for normal service. Manufacturer
recommends regular or unleaded au-
tomotive gasoline having an 85 mini-
mum octane rating. Gasoline and oil
should be thoroughly mixed.

FUEL PUMP. A diaphragm fuel
pump (Fig_ SZ3-2) is mounted on the
side of power head cylinder block and is
actuated by pressure and vacuum pulsa-
tions from the engine crankcase.
When servicing pump, defective or
questionable parts should be renewed.
Diaphragm should be renewed if air
leaks or cracks are found, or if
deterioration is evident.
SPEED CONTROL LINKAGE.
Engine speed is controlled by position of
throttle linkage. Ignition advance is
electronically controlled. A twist grip at
the steering handle is used to control
throttle settings.

7. SERVICE MANUAL
LUBRICATION
The power head is lubricated by oil
mixed with the fuel. Recommended oil
is Suzuki Outboard Motor Oil or a good
quality NMMA certified TC-W two-
stroke engine oil. Recommended fuel is
no-lead or regular automotive gasoline
having an 85-95 octane rating. Fuel and
oil shouId be thoroughly mixed .
On all models except OTI5C, fuel:oil
ratio should be 30:1 during break-in of
a new or rebuilt engine. On DT9.9 and
OT15 models prior to 1986, fuel ratio af-
ter initial .5 hours of operation should
be 50: I when using a recommended oil.
On 1986 and later D1'9.9 and DT15
models, fuel ratio after initial 15 hours
of operation should be 100:1 when us-
ing a recommended oil.
Model DTl5C is equipped with auto-
matic oil iliection. When breaking-in a
new or rebuilt engine, mix a recom-
mended oil with the gasoline at a 50:1
ratio in combination with the oil iliec-
lion system to ensure sufficient lubri-
cation during break-in. Switch to
straight gasoline after completion of the
first tank of fuel.
Oil iIiection system on Model DTl5C
is equipped with a renewable oil filter
between oil tank and oil pump. Renew
filter after 50 hours of operation or af-
ter three months.
The lower unit gears and bearings are
lubricated by approximately 170 mL
(5.7 ozs.) of SAE 90 hypoid outboard
gear oil. Reinstall vent and fill plugs se-
curely using a new gasket, if necessary,
to ensure a water tight seal.
FUEL SYSTEM
CARBURETOR. A Mikuni B24-15
carburetor is used on D1'9.9 models and
Mikuni B24-18 carburetor is used on
DTl5 and DT15C models. Refer to Fig.
SZ6-1 for exploded view of carburetor.
Initial setling of pilot air screw (2) from
a lightly seated pOSition should be 1-114
to 1-3/4 turns on DT9.9 and OT15
models prior to 1987, 1-118 to 1-5/8
turns on Model DT9.9 after 1986, 7/8 to
1-3/8 turns on DTl5 models after 1986
and 1-li2 to 2 turns on Model OTI5C.
Final carburetor adjustment should be
made with engine running at normal
operating temperature in forward gear.
Adjust idle speed screw (4) so engine
idles at approximately 600-650 rpm. Ad-
just pilot air screw so engine idles
smoothly and will accelerate cleanly
without hesitation. As adjustments af-
fect each other, readjustment of idle
speed may be necessary.
Main fuel metering is controlled by
main jet (13). Standard main jet size for
normal operation is #110 on DT9.9
models, #122.5 on early DTl5 models
Suzuki OT9.9 & OT15 (1983-1987) & 0T15C (1988)
(prior to 1987) and #125 on late DTl5
and all OTI5C models. Standard pilotjet
(6) size is #52.5 on DT9.9 models, #57.5
on OTI5 models and #65 on DTl5C
models.

FUEL FILTER. A fuel filter assembly
mounted on engine port side is used to
filter the fuel prior to entering the fuel
pump assembly. Periodically unscrew
cup (5-Fig. SZ6-3) from base (1) and
withdraw filter element (4). Clean cup
(5) and filter element (4) in a suitable
solvent and blow dry with clean com-
pressed air. Inspect filter element (4).
If excessive blockage or damage is not-
ed, then the element must be renewed.
Reassembly is reverse order of disas-
sembly. Renew .'0" ring (3) and, if
needed, seal (2) during reassembly.
